S E C ® R <br /> k <br /> short term, and in the long term, have generally declined over time The dissolved <br /> plume remains defined In all directions by the existing monitoring well network, except <br /> northeast of off-site Shell wells S-5 and S-6 <br /> 0 <br /> CHARACTERIZATION STATUS <br /> The highest concentrations of TPPH and MtBE have been detected in well MW-7 in the <br /> vicinity of the former USTs The highest concentrations of TBA have been detected in <br /> wells MW-3 and MW-7 In the vicinity of the former USTs, and in well MW-11, located <br /> north of the former USTs The extent of the GRO plume has been delineated, except <br /> west of Shell well S-1 The dissolved MtBE plume has laterally been delineated, except <br /> northeast of Shell wells S-5 and S-6 The presence of dissolved TBA has been <br /> delineated In all directions, except northeast of Shell wells S-5 and S-6, and west of <br /> Shell well S-1 <br /> WASTE DISPOSAL <br /> The volume of purged groundwater generated during the first quarter 2005, and the <br /> method of disposal are documented in TRC's Quarterly Monitoring Report, January <br /> through March 2005 dated April 4, 2005 (Attachment 1) <br /> REMEDIAL PERFORMANCE SUMMARY <br /> An OS system has been operational at the site since December 20, 2002 A summary ; <br /> of the operation of the ozone injection system and monthly groundwater sampling <br /> activities are presented in the following sections <br /> Ozone Infection Operation <br /> The OS system consists of a wall mounted KVA C-Sparge TM System, model 5020, that <br /> produces 4 grams per hour (0 009 pounds per hour) of ozone As recommended in <br /> Gettler Ryan's Groundwater Monitoring Well, CPT, and Ozone Microsparge System <br /> Installation Report dated May 9, 2003, the OS system had been programmed to inject <br /> ozone In to 10 wells (SP-1 through SP-10) for between 5 and 15 minutes for each well <br /> cycling 16 times per day On March 22, 2005, the system was found not to be operating <br /> due to the ground fault current Interrupter (GFCI) being tripped The GFCI was reset y <br /> and the system was reprogrammed and restarted <br /> During the current quarter (December 2, 2004 to March 11, 2005), the OS system was <br /> operational for 83 percent of the programmed run time, resulting in 1,457 hours of <br /> operation and 13 pounds of ozone Injected Cumulatively, the OS system has operated <br /> for 9,499 hours, and has injected a total of approximately 85 pounds of ozone Table 1 <br /> presents the operating data for the OS system, and includes operating hours and <br /> pressure readings Remediation system field data sheets are included in Attachment 2 r <br /> Monthly Groundwater Sampling <br /> Monthly groundwater samples are collected from monitoring wells MW-3 and MW-4, and <br /> analyzed for TPHg, BTEX, and MtBE and TBA by EPA Method 8260B Results of the <br /> t°4r <br /> 11ConocoPhdlips\Retad Sites1111921QSSR1200511Q2005 QSSR and QRPS doc <br />
